Men’s Crew Cracks Top 10
4/8/2009 1:46:14 PM | Men's Rowing
SYRACUSE – The Syracuse University men's crew squad moved up four places to number nine in the latest USRowing Men's Varsity Eight Collegiate Coaches' Poll. The Orange was ranked 13th in last week's preseason poll, but vaulted into the top 10 with its strong showing at the San Diego Crew Classic. The Orange won the Men's Collegiate Varsity International Petite on April 5 and finished fourth in its heat on April 3.
SU's jump was the largest of any crew in the poll. Syracuse has been ranked in the top 13 during the last three seasons, peaking at No. 8 on May 9, 2007. SU's spot in this week's poll is its highest since it was also ninth on May 23, 2007
SU is back on the water Saturday, April 18 when its hosts No. 13 Navy and No. 11 Cornell for the Goes Trophy.
